Understanding the Importance of Payroll Systems

Payroll systems are not just about processing employee payments. They play a crucial role in ensuring compliance with tax regulations, managing benefits, and maintaining employee morale. An efficient payroll system can save time, reduce errors, and ultimately lead to a happier workforce.

Understanding how payroll impacts various aspects of your business is essential. It’s not just a monthly chore; it’s a critical function that enables your organization to function smoothly. When employees are paid accurately and on time, it fosters a sense of value and trust within the company.

Choosing the Right Payroll Software

The right payroll software can make all the difference. With numerous options available, it’s essential to evaluate your company’s specific needs. Look for software that offers user-friendly interfaces, automation features, and robust reporting capabilities.

Consider how scalable the software is, especially if you’re anticipating growth. Features like cloud access can offer flexibility, allowing you and your employees to access payroll information from anywhere. Integration with other business systems, like HR and accounting software, can also streamline operations significantly.

Automating Payroll Processes

Automation is a game-changer when it comes to payroll. Manual data entry is not only time-consuming but also opens the door to human error. By automating payroll, you can drastically reduce the likelihood of mistakes.

Consider implementing an automated payroll system that will calculate wages, withhold taxes, and even manage benefits. With automation, you can schedule payroll runs, generate payslips, and handle deductions without lifting a finger. This not only saves time but also ensures that everything is done accurately and consistently.

Keeping Up with Compliance and Regulations

Payroll isnt static; it’s constantly changing due to new laws and regulations. Staying updated is essential for smooth operations. Non-compliance can lead to hefty fines and damage your company’s reputation.

Investing in payroll systems that offer compliance updates is crucial. Many software solutions provide automatic updates to ensure your payroll aligns with current laws, making it easier for businesses to stay compliant. Regular training and resource allocation for your payroll team can also minimize risk on this front.

Training Your Team

Even with an automated system in place, human oversight remains vital. Its necessary to have a knowledgeable team managing payroll. Investing in training programs for your staff can empower them to utilize the payroll system effectively.

Focus on specific areas such as understanding software capabilities, compliance regulations, and reporting functions. Regular training sessions can keep your team informed about updates and new features in the system, maximizing the return on your software investment.

Creating a Positive Payroll Experience for Employees

Payroll isn’t just an administrative function; it directly affects your employees satisfaction and trust in the organization. Ensuring that your payroll system offers easy access to payslips and payment histories can improve transparency.

Consider implementing an employee self-service portal where team members can update their personal information, access tax documents, and review payment histories. This not only empowers employees but also reduces the administrative burden on your payroll staff.

Utilizing Analytics for Insight

Many modern payroll systems come equipped with analytical tools that can provide valuable insights into labor costs, overtime, and employee productivity. Leveraging these insights can help you make informed business decisions.

Create reports to analyze trends and track metrics that are important to your organization. Understanding these metrics can assist in budget planning and identifying areas where you can optimize costs.

By using data analytics, payroll can transition from simply counting beans to being a strategic asset that influences broader business decisions.
